Government Constitutes National Dental Commission
On 19th March 2026, in a major reform aimed at improving the quality of dental education and aligning it with global standards, the Centre notified the constitution of the National Dental Commission (NDC) under the National Dental Commission Act, 2023.
- With the National Dental Commission Act, 2023 coming into force, the Dentists Act, 1948, stands repealed, and the Dental Council of India dissolved.
Why did the Government dissolve the Dental Council of India (DCI)?
- DCI regulated dental education and the profession for decades, but faced issues like lack of transparency, uneven standards, and outdated practices.
